On 8/9/2004 12:53 PM, Josh Berkus wrote: > People, > >> > DELETE FROM target_tbl USING other_tbls WHERE ... >> >> Feels much more understandable. The second FROM looks like a hickup. > > Yes, although imagine: > > DELETE FROM staff USING users JOIN logons USING (user_id) > WHERE last_logon < ( now() - '6 months'); > > Not as bad as FROM, but still a bit baffling to look at. Still, I can't > think of anything else that wouldn't require inventing a new reserved word. What about DELETE FROM staff JOIN users ... then? > > Oh, and MySQL's "multi-table deletes": PLEASE tell me that's not > SQL-standard. > Yes, not standard.
